The Camden Hills Windjammers will take on the Bangor Rams at 8: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Camden Hills kn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 55 points or more in their past 19 matchups -- so hopefully Bangor likes a good challenge.
Camden Hills is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Saturday. Everything went their way against Skowhegan as they made off with a 69-44 victory. The Windjammers haven't had any issues with the River Hawks recently, as the game was their seventh consecutive win against them.
Meanwhile, Bangor hadn't done well against Lewiston recently (they were 1-8 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Saturday. The Rams walked away with a 54-43 victory over the Blue Devils. Give some credit to the fans of both teams: the last three times they've met, the home team has come away the winner.
Camden Hills' win bumped their record up to 18-1. As for Bangor, their victory bumped their record up to 12-8.
Everything came up roses for Camden Hills against Bangor in their previous meeting back in December of 2025, as the squad secured a 62-34 win. Will the Windjammers repeat their success, or do the Rams have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
